SEC v. COLON END PARENTHESIS TRUST LLC, et al.
On July 9, 2007 the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) filed a complaint in the U. S. District Court (see link below) naming Clayton Kimbrell, Trevor Reed and certain Colon End Parenthesis entities as defendants in the matter. Mr. Reed and Mr. Kimbrell consented to the appointment of a receiver, the freezing of their assets, and on July 10, 2007, I was appointed receiver of the corporate entities (see link below).
The tasks of the Receiver include marshalling and liquidating the assets of the Receiver entities, asserting claims against third parties where appropriate, and making such distributions to creditors and/or investors as directed by the Court. This case is at a very preliminary stage, but I am proceeding as quickly as possbile to implement this order. The servers handling CEP Trust and related .com entities have been disconnected from the internet in order to preserve what may be the only viable records documenting the activity of the entities. We will be reviewing this data in order to trace funds, determine who is owed money, and to determine where to look for other assets. Because of the relationship with CEP Trust, Coastin88.com and CEPcoast.com, it was necessary to also disconnect those servers.
The Order requires me to make an interim report in not less than 45 days. In the meantime, this site will be used to communicate whatever information, documents, and events that can be made available. At sometime in the future, a claims filing process will be undertaken, and we will post the forms and details here in to assist in that process. But we do not presently know what assets there will be to distribute, if any. It is not presently possible to set a time frame for any distributions. We will add an FAQ section to this site as soon as possible to address the primary questions you may have.
